调试程序时应当使用(调试程序时应当使用什么语言)
调试程序时应当使用
1. 调试器调试程序时应当使用,记录。调试器调试程序时应当使用:调试器是专门用于调试程序调试程序时应当使用的工具。它可以逐行执行代码并查看变量的值,以帮助查找程序中的错误。日志记录调试程序时应当使用:在程序中添加日志记录可以帮助调试程序时应当使用了解程序的执行过程以及程序在不同时间点的状态。
2、第一步,使用编辑程序将编译好的源程序以一定的书写格式发送到计算机。编辑程序会根据用户的意图对源程序进行添加、删除或修改。
3. lint 程序和编译器提供的一个典型功能是编译时检查,这是调试器所不具备的。当您使用这些工具编译程序时,它们将识别程序中有问题的部分、可能产生意外影响的部分以及常见错误。
要以较少的信号线下载并调试stm32程序应该采用哪种方式
1. 使用USB 转TTL 线将程序烧写到stm32f103C8T6 中: TXD - 连接PA10/USART1_RX RXD - 连接PA9/USART1_TX 3V3 GND 连接电源调试程序时应当使用。将BOOT0连接到3V3,然后供电进入下载模式。烧写程序成功后,BOO0和BOOT1都被置0。
2. Jtag是一种在线调试标准,由4条信号线组成。您所有的调试程序时应当使用程序下载和调试模拟都是通过jtag接口执行的。连接stm32 jtag接口和计算机的设备称为仿真器。
3、芯片厂家一般都会预留几种烧录程序的方式,其中比较常见的是串口。不同的芯片厂家有不同的烧录方法。例如STM32需要设置BOOT0和BOOT1引脚来设置当前烧录程序位置。
4、这里采用FSMC方式,将TFT当作一个内存块来读写数据。第一张图是错误的,不明白设计意图。
5.“”0X? “指令无法‘读’或‘写’”引用的“0x00000000”内存,然后关闭应用程序。如果你向一些“专家”寻求建议,你得到的答案往往是诸如“Windows这么不稳定”之类的愤慨和不屑。
6. BOOT1=x BOOT0=0 从用户闪存启动,这是正常工作模式。 BOOT1=0 BOOT0=1 从系统内存启动。在此模式下启动的程序功能由制造商设置。 BOOT1=1 BOOT0=1 从内置SRAM启动,该模式可用于调试。
调试程序时应当使用什么进行调试
调试器调试程序时应当使用,记录。调试器:调试器是调试程序时应当使用专门用于调试程序的工具。它可以逐行执行代码并查看变量的值调试程序时应当使用,以帮助查找程序中的错误。日志记录:在程序中添加日志记录可以帮助调试程序时应当使用了解程序的执行过程以及程序在不同时间点的状态。
第一步是使用编辑程序将准备好的源程序以一定的书写格式发送到计算机。编辑程序会根据用户的意图对源程序进行添加、删除或修改。
Windows 10系统下,可以使用Debug命令行工具进行DOS调试。详细步骤如下: 打开命令行工具。在Windows 10 中,可以通过按Win + X 键,然后选择命令提示符或Windows PowerShell 打开它。
作为职场新人,在签订合同时都有哪些坑?
责任坑这里有一个坑,看似不起眼,但一查就不清楚,那就是责任问题。比如一个项目,最终负责人签字那一栏,谁签字谁负责。
查明资金何时发放,询问使用期限,聘用新员工时该怎么办。上一份工作中,我因为没有仔细阅读合同,被公司欺骗了。他们说要我做人力资源助理,但实际上要我做销售。我觉得这个说法特别过分。
劳动合同是劳动者与用人单位之间依法建立劳动关系、明确双方权利和义务的协议。
事故单位:看似正规却混乱的皮包公司;受害人:“饥肠辘辘”合同是保护申请人合法权益的利器。因此,求职者在签订劳动合同时,一定要仔细研究,谨慎行事,四处考察,详细了解条款后再签字。
很多人在求职过程中都遇到过以下“坑”,切不可踩: 没有正规渠道招聘人员招聘是单位的一项重要工作,也是企业形象的重要组成部分。一般单位不关心这个项目。我们非常重视我们的工作,会派出专门的人员通过正规渠道进行招聘。
试用期有哪些陷阱?试用期是多少个月?事实上,签订劳动合同并不一定需要试用期。
用户的程序在计算器系统中运行,通常要经过那几个步骤?
首先你要知道程序是放在硬盘上的;如果你不运行它,它就会死;只有当你运行它时,操作系统才会将程序加载到内存中;程序开始运行;程序运行。这时操作系统就会给它分配一段内存来存放程序以及运行时产生的数据。
开发一个C语言程序需要四个步骤:编辑、编译、连接、运行。 C语言程序可以在任何架构的处理器上使用,只要该架构的处理器有相应的C语言编译器和库,然后可以将C源代码编译并连接成目标二进制文件然后运行。
对于要执行的指令,计算机必须执行程序,即计算机读取程序,然后按照确切的顺序执行程序中编码的步骤,直到程序完成。一个程序可以被执行多次,每次用户向计算机输入不同的选项和数据,都可能得到不同的结果。
冯诺依曼架构计算机的工作原理可以概括为八个字:存储程序、程序控制。
操作系统将目标程序传送到主存中,由中央处理器处理,结果存储在辅助存储器中。 运算结果由操作系统按照用户要求的格式发送到外部设备输出。计算机内部工作(~)是在操作系统控制下的一个复杂的过程。
一般来说,开机过程有以下几个步骤: 开机——打开电源开关,为主板和内部风扇供电。 启动引导程序——CPU开始执行ROM BIOS中存储的指令。
...指令引用的0xf943cf33内存.该内存不能为read要终止程序
例1:打开IE浏览器或者几分钟之内,就会出现0x70dcf39f指令引用的0x00000000内存。该内存无法被“读取”。
使用系统自带的sfc命令修复损坏的系统文件,使其恢复到正常状态。
方法金山卫士-百宝箱-电脑医生-软件问题:“内存无法读取”项修复。方法工具修复(发送修复工具,电脑在线下载修复)。
内存条坏了(多是二手内存)。使用了有质量问题的内存。内存插入主板的金手指部分灰尘太多。使用不同品牌容量不同的内存,导致不兼容。超频引起的散热问题。
应该是操作系统提示该指令非法读取。可能是软件越界或者其他越界行为。出现这个问题主要有几个方面: 计算机病毒感染。解决办法:使用杀毒软件进行杀毒。主要的硬件原因是内存模块不兼容。
一般是兼容性问题。先插上原来的看看能不能开机,或者换一个。如果可以,说明内存没有问题。如果没有,请清除CMOS。一般主板上都有一个标记。如果找不到,请从主板上取下电池。
C语言中用ASSERT调试的八大技巧
断言的语法格式为:其中条件是需要判断的表达式。如果为False,则会抛出AssertionError并输出错误消息。断言的使用在程序调试和测试中非常有用。它可以快速判断表达式的值是否符合预期并及时发现错误。
使用断言来捕获不应该发生的非法情况。不要混淆非法情况和错误情况之间的区别,后者必然存在并且必须予以处理。 (2) 使用断言来确认函数的参数。
断言可以放置在正常情况下程序不会到达的地方:assert false 断言可用于检查传递给私有方法的参数。
c语言中的assert()。这个宏在使用assert时,给它一个参数,即一个计算结果为true的表达式。预处理器生成测试断言的代码,如果断言不正确,则会发出一条错误消息,告诉断言是什么以及它失败了一段时间,然后程序终止。
c语言中用调试方式观察每一步的数据,这该怎么弄啊?要具体的步骤,是在vs...
具有图形界面的编程工具调试程序时应当使用。调试时右键单击变量时,会出现查看值选项。选择后即可查看。如果没有图形界面,则需要输入相应的指令。具体说明需要查阅编程工具相应的帮助文档。
点击首先需要设置断点的代码行前面,会出现一个红球,表示断点设置成功。下图一共设置了4个断点。设置断点后,按F5开始断点调试。无论断点到达的地方,红球上都会添加一个黄色箭头。
调试程序时应当使用有多种方法: 1)单步调试跟踪变量值。 2)如上所述,使用临时变量来保存其值并进行比较。 3)Printf()要查看其值的地方; C语言是一种面向过程的、抽象的通用编程语言,广泛应用于底层开发。
使用Visual Studio 2010编译C语言的具体步骤如下:首先双击打开Vs 2010,找到左上角的新建项目点击打开,选择win32控制台程序,命名文件,例如123,然后单击“确定”。
数控车床的调试规范主要包括哪些内容?
数控机床机械部分主要包括调试程序时应当使用:机床基础件、主传动系统、进给传动系统、润滑系统、冷却系统、液压系统、气动系统、保护系统等。产生故障的原因大多是由于不正确的安装和调试调试程序时应当使用。操作过程中的失误造成碰撞,导致机械传动故障,导轨运动时摩擦阻力过大。
调整机床主轴正反转,检查机床开关按钮及功能是否正常。 使用注意事项: 机床操作人员必须是经过正规培训、合格的人员。使用机床时,机床操作人员必须阅读机床使用说明书,了解其内容后才能操作机床。
机床功能调试为调试程序时应当使用。我们对调整后的机床进行试车,检查和调试机床的各项功能。调试前,首先应检查机床数控系统和可编程控制器的设定参数是否与随机表中的数据一致。
调试c程序,需要几个步骤?
首先是分析需求、设计程序、编辑程序、调试程序四个阶段。
分别是分析需求、设计程序、编辑程序、调试程序四个阶段。
打开我们的程序,点击菜单栏右侧的start/stopdebug.按钮,进入调试模式,如下图。寄存器窗口在左侧,汇编窗口在右上角。我们可以看到各个寄存器的值以及C语言对应的汇编代码,如下所示。
将源代码编译成目标程序(二进制程序),并将目标程序与其他库文件链接起来,形成可执行程序进行调试。如果程序运行时出现错误,请从头开始执行。在计算机上输入和编辑源程序。通过键盘将程序输入计算机。如果发现错误,请及时纠正。
在计算机上运行C程序的步骤主要包括以下调试程序时应当使用: 编写代码:首先,调试程序时应当使用你需要编写一个C程序。您可以使用任何文本编辑器,例如记事本、Sublime Text,或更专业的集成开发环境(IDE),例如Visual Studio Code、Eclipse 等。
点击添加命令添加启动执行(不调试),上下移动到后面。如下图所示,编译并调试完程序后,只需在此工具栏上从左到右单击3次即可。这些按钮是:生成、生成解决方案并开始执行(不进行调试)。
OD调试器的简单使用方法
1. 操作步骤如下: 打开OD软件,选择需要调试的程序,打开该程序的进程。在OD软件中,选择“文件”菜单,单击“新建”按钮创建一个新的调试器窗口。
2、第一种方法:这种方法其实不叫调试。这也是一种愚蠢的方法。就是利用MessageBox来输出程序的一些中间信息,这样就可以找出程序中的问题出在哪里。你也可以在try catch中使用它并使用MessageBox弹出异常。这种方法也比较直观。
3. 按F2 设置断点,按Alt+b 打开断点编辑器,编辑所有已设置的断点。空格键可以快速切换断点状态。当您在CALL中,想要返回到本次CALL被调用的地方时,可以按“Ctrl+F9”快捷键执行返回功能。
4、该内存下的内存/硬件访问断点,选择数据,右键OD10,直接用OD01Ctrl+F5设置硬件断点。建议阅读小龟的OD教程,补充基础知识。网上也有很多帖子教授OD的基本用法。
5.最简单的方法是启动OllyDbg,单击文件|打开,然后选择要调试的程序。该程序需要在对话框下方的文本字段中输入命令行参数。重新开始调试上一个程序的快捷键是Ctrl+F2,OllyDbg使用相同的参数。您也可以单击历史记录。
对C语言进行调试的最好方法是什么?
1. 首先调试程序中较小的组件,然后调试较大的组件。如果你的程序写得好,它将包含一些较小的组件。最好先验证程序的这些部分是否正确。
2、简单来说有两种方式:一是源码调试,就是分析源码找到bug位置。一般用printf()打印出程序执行的每一步信息;另一种是可执行文件调试,需要使用调试器来进行。
3. 断言为开发人员提供了一种在代码库中出现缺陷时发现缺陷的好方法。调试是开发嵌入式系统中最耗时、最令人沮丧的事情之一。
4. 将其另存为c 或c++ 文件。 2.根据断点调试,查找错误。 3、使用F10或F11单步调试,找出精确的错误。其中,f10是跳过函数窃取,f11是进入函数体调试。
5、然后F5开始运行,停在红点处。然后,如果您查看变量值,就会在下面的框中出现一条错误消息。这是非常清楚的。 Shift+F5 结束调试。 F10 位于操作被中断的框的下一行。变量有变化。将鼠标放在红点上,按F9取消断点。
6、分析需求、设计程序、编辑程序、调试程序。这是四个阶段。
关于调试程序时应该使用什么的介绍就到此为止。感谢您花时间阅读本网站的内容。有关调试程序时应使用哪种语言以及调试程序时应使用哪些信息的更多信息,请不要忘记搜索此站点。
评论
古城白衣少年殇
回复中断的框的下一行。变量有变化。将鼠标放在红点上,按F9取消断点。6、分析需求、设计程序、编辑程序、调试程序。这是四个阶段。关于调试程序时应该使用什么的介绍就到此为止。感谢您花时间阅读本网站的内容。有关调试程序时应使用哪种语言
前尘未谋
回复正。在计算机上运行C程序的步骤主要包括以下调试程序时应当使用: 编写代码:首先,调试程序时应当使用你需要编写一个C程序。您可以使用任何文本编辑器,例如记事本、Sublime Text,或更专业的集成开发环境(IDE),例如Visual Studio Code、E
隐形的鸡翅膀
回复作原理可以概括为八个字:存储程序、程序控制。操作系统将目标程序传送到主存中,由中央处理器处理,结果存储在辅助存储器中。 运算结果由操作系统按照用户要求的格式发送到外部设备输出。计算机内部工作(~)是在操作系统控制下的一个复杂的过程。一般来
前尘未谋
回复辅助存储器中。 运算结果由操作系统按照用户要求的格式发送到外部设备输出。计算机内部工作(~)是在操作系统控制下的一个复杂的过程。一般来说,开机过程有以下几个步骤: